What is the difference between Entry Level Remote Claims Processor vs Claims Analyst?

AspectEntry Level Remote Claims ProcessorClaims Analyst
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ic understanding of insurance policiesHigh school diploma; some roles may prefer or require a degree in finance or related field
Work EnvironmentRemote, independent work with minimal supervisionPrimarily office-based or remote, often involving data analysis
Employer & Industry UsageInsurance companies, third-party administrators, healthcare providersInsurance firms, healthcare organizations, financial services
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

The Entry Level Remote Claims Processor typically handles initial claim intake and basic processing tasks, requiring minimal experience. Claims Analysts often perform detailed data analysis and review, sometimes requiring additional certifications or experience. While both roles work in insurance and healthcare industries and can be remote, Claims Analysts usually have more analytical responsibilities and may require higher credentials.

Job description

The Underwriting Center Underwriter will underwrite Middle Market and Construction renewal business, deploying effective account management while fostering strong relationships with agency partners.  This role is responsible for providing technical underwriting expertise through timely and streamlined processes to best serve agents and policyholders. This role underwrites renewals and services accounts to primarily manage UFG’s Middle Market and Construction business.

Responsibilities: 

  • Profitably underwrite renewal business through risk selection, pricing, contractual integrity, and account management, in accordance with delegated authority, and ensuring regulatory compliance.
    • Develop, analyze, and evaluate information and exposure to loss. 
    • Document assigned files with underwriting thought process.
    • Properly classify and price risk commensurate with exposures and controls.
  • Proactively identify and execute opportunities to up sell and cross-sell UFG coverages and products.
  • Provide exceptional service to agency partners with timely execution of policy services such as endorsement requests and other agent inquiries.
  • Collaborate with Business Unit, Line of Business and Field Underwriting, Underwriting Support, Sales and Distribution, Risk Control, Legal, Claims, and other internal partners to ensure optimal stakeholder management.
  • Actively assists with the review and analysis of the portfolio to ensure progress toward key business objectives.

Qualifications: 

Education: 

  • 4-year college degree preferred.
  • Completion of or working towards AU, CIC, or CPCU designation preferred.

Experience: 

  • 1-2 years of commercial lines insurance underwriting experience preferred.

Knowledge, skills & abilities: 

  • Risk evaluation skills and solid insurance contract knowledge.
  • Fluently comprehend, identify, and determine appropriate coverage forms.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ment while prioritizing and completing work efficiently and effectively.
  • Capability to execute current underwriting strategy for assigned territory to make effective underwriting decisions. 
  • Ability to establish a high degree of trust for internal and external customers.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with an affinity for detailed accuracy.
  • Effective commun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Strong time management skills with the ability to meet deadlines and effective dates.
  • Ability to provide excellent customer service.

Working Conditions:  

  • General office environment; remote, in-office, and hybrid options determined by manager.
  • Occasional travel required.
